Madeleine Eyland (Belgian/British 1930-2021): 'Only Silence', 'Hope and Mystery' and 'Sepia Seascape', three pastels signed, max 22cm x 30cm (3) Provenance: artist's studio collection. Marie-Madeleine Eyland (ne� Legrain) was born in 1930 at Floriffoux, Belgium; she lived most of her life in Scarborough working as a nurse and an artist.
Life boat - Watercolour, oil paint and postage stamp. Watercolour and oil paints sensitively enhance the scene from within this vintage stamp creating an atmospheric seascape. Combining art with stamps ensures these tiny pieces of postal history are no longer hidden away in stamp albums and are on display to be enjoyed everyday.
New Day New Hope - Mixed Media - textiles acrylic. ‘I have called the piece ‘New Day New Hope’ it is created using textiles and acrylic paints. I was inspired by my love for a seascape and how people are feeling at this stage in the pandemic. The current situation with the vaccines being rolled out and the easing of restrictions means that each day brings better news and there seems to be a light at the end of the tunnel.’
